The Instagram account "@offen.katholisch" is using the "Priest Application" campaign to draw attention to the desire for a priesthood for all. In an interview with katholisch.de, co-initiator Josy Henning explains what the group hopes to achieve.
The "offen.katholisch" initiative, founded in 2022 by young Catholics from the Diocese of Dresden-Meissen, advocates for a diverse, inclusive, and discrimination-free church. It particularly calls for marriage equality and the priesthood for women. The group became known through an open letter to Bishop Heinrich Timmerevers and the petition "Declaration of Love for a Church for All."
